RCE Attack: Understanding the Risks and Solutions

Remote Code Execution (RCE) attacks pose a significant threat to AI systems, especially in multi-cloud or partner-integrated environments. These attacks allow threat actors to execute arbitrary code on a target system, potentially leading to devastating consequences. As the CTO, it is crucial to recognize the gravity of RCE attacks and take proactive measures to mitigate the associated risks. Here are some key points to consider:

– RCE attacks can result in unauthorized access to sensitive data, compromising the confidentiality and integrity of critical information.

– Attackers can exploit vulnerabilities in AI systems to gain control and execute malicious commands, leading to system disruption and potential financial loss.

– Inadequate visibility and control over potentially malicious, drifted, or poisoned tools further expose AI systems to RCE attacks, necessitating the implementation of robust security measures.

There's a phrase burned into the brain of every security professional who's been doing this long enough: compliance does not equal security. In other words, you can’t be secure through documentation. We’ve learned that lesson the hard way, consistently watching organizations pass compliance reviews while still getting breached. A perfectly completed questionnaire has never stopped a ransomware attack. A SOC 2 report has never blocked a credential stuffing campaign. Documentation describes a security posture. It doesn't create one.
